Understanding VARK and Its Impact on Learning

The VARK model, developed by Neil Fleming, categorizes learning preferences into four primary types:

  • Visual (V): Learners prefer to see information presented graphically, using charts, diagrams, infographics, videos, and demonstrations.
  • Auditory (A): Learners absorb information best through listening, such as lectures, discussions, podcasts, and audio explanations.
  • Read/Write (R): Learners prefer text-based content, including manuals, reports, articles, lists, and the act of taking notes.
  • Kinesthetic (K): Learners thrive on hands-on experiences, simulations, role-playing, practical exercises, and real-world application.

Understanding these preferences is foundational. When training material aligns with an individual's VARK style, comprehension improves, engagement soars, and the likelihood of applying new skills increases significantly. Conversely, forcing a visual learner through an audio-only course, or a kinesthetic learner through a purely text-based module, leads to frustration, disengagement, and poor learning outcomes.

The Power of Adaptive Delivery

Adaptive delivery is a dynamic, data-driven approach to learning that personalizes content, pace, and pathway based on a learner's individual performance, preferences, and goals. Unlike static courses, an adaptive system constantly assesses the learner's progress and adjusts the learning journey in real-time. This ensures that learners are always challenged appropriately – not bored by redundant information, nor overwhelmed by advanced concepts they're not ready for.

AI-Driven Insights for Hyper-Personalization

As L&D leaders, you might wonder: How can sophisticated technology truly personalize corporate training for a workforce with diverse learning styles and prior knowledge?

The answer lies in artificial intelligence and machine learning. Modern learning platforms leverage AI to analyze vast amounts of learner data – from completion rates and quiz scores to content interactions and time spent on modules. This data helps the system infer individual learning preferences, identify specific knowledge gaps, and even predict areas where a learner might struggle. Based on these insights, the system can dynamically adjust the learning path, recommend additional resources, or present content in an alternative VARK-preferred format. This is the essence of Adaptive Learning, making every minute of training highly efficient and impactful.
